ポリモーフィズム– tag –
-
Javaでポリモーフィズムを使って動的型付けをシミュレーションする方法
Javaのポリモーフィズムは、同じインターフェースや親クラスを持つ異なるクラスのオブジェクトを一貫して扱うことを可能にする重要な概念です。この性質を活用すること... -
Javaの抽象クラスとポリモーフィズムを活用した戦略パターンの実装方法を徹底解説
Javaプログラミングにおいて、設計パターンはコードの再利用性や保守性を向上させる重要な要素です。特に戦略パターンは、アルゴリズムを動的に切り替えることができる... -
Javaの継承とポリモーフィズムを用いた効果的なエラーハンドリング設計
Javaのオブジェクト指向特性である継承とポリモーフィズムは、エラーハンドリングの設計において非常に強力なツールとなります。これらの概念を活用することで、コード... -
Javaの継承とポリモーフィズムを使いこなすオブジェクト指向設計の極意
Javaは、オブジェクト指向プログラミングの世界で広く使われている言語であり、その強力な機能である「継承」と「ポリモーフィズム」は、柔軟かつ再利用可能なコードを... -
Javaポリモーフィズムで実現する柔軟なAPI設計とベストプラクティス
ポリモーフィズムは、Javaをはじめとするオブジェクト指向プログラミングにおいて、柔軟で拡張性の高いAPI設計を実現するための重要な概念です。API設計においては、異... -
Javaのインターフェースを使ったポリモーフィズムの効果的な実装法
Javaのオブジェクト指向プログラミングにおいて、ポリモーフィズム(多態性)は、コードの再利用性と柔軟性を高める重要な概念です。特に、Javaのインターフェースを利... -
Javaの継承とポリモーフィズムで実現するプラグインアーキテクチャ設計
Javaはその強力なオブジェクト指向機能を活用して、柔軟で拡張可能なアーキテクチャを設計することが可能です。その中でも、継承とポリモーフィズムを活用したプラグイ... -
Javaにおけるポリモーフィズムと動的メソッドディスパッチの仕組みを徹底解説
Javaのポリモーフィズムと動的メソッドディスパッチは、オブジェクト指向プログラミングにおいて非常に重要な概念です。これらは、柔軟で拡張性のあるコードを作成する... -
Javaのポリモーフィズムを活用したデザインパターンの実践ガイド
Javaでソフトウェア開発を行う際、ポリモーフィズムはコードの柔軟性と再利用性を向上させるための強力なツールとなります。特に、デザインパターンを効果的に適用する...